Save the Date -- Celebrate the Generosity of Lowell's Business Community
SAVE THE DATE!
This year the City will highlight those companies that are committed to giving back to the community and spotlight the partnerships between businesses and non-profit organizations that enrich and sustain the City.
Friday, November 4th, 2011
12:00 - 2:00 PM
UMass Lowell Inn and Conference Center
50 Warren Street
Lowell MA
